Why are vampires always in New Orleans?
During the 19th century, the presence of infectious diseases in New Orleans fueled fear, superstitions and folklore — including the existence of vampires in New Orleans, according to the New Orleans Pharmacy Museum.Both diseases were prominent during the 19th century in the South and New England area.

Are there vampires and witches in New Orleans?
There are several voodoo shops, some touristy, some authentic, offering guidance in the religion. There are witchcraft shops selling spells, potions and insight on the pagan religion and culture, and the only vampire shop in the country also found its home in the very heart of the French Quarter.

How did voodoo come to New Orleans?
Origins of Voodoo in New Orleans
Voodoo was bolstered when followers fleeing Haiti after the 1791 slave revolt moved to New Orleans and grew as many free people of color made its practice an important part of their culture. Voodoo queens and kings were spiritual and political figures of power in 1800s New Orleans.
